The Mission:
Stay Longer. Experience More.
Azamara’s mission is fundamentally different from the "floating resort" model. Their operational strategy—Destination Immersion—prioritizes late-night departures and overnight stays in nearly every port of call. This allows guests to experience the nightlife, local dining, and culture of a city in a way that standard 8-to-5 port schedules do not permit.
The line maintains a mid-tier luxury position, focusing on a convivial, country-club atmosphere. By operating smaller, uniform vessels, they can navigate narrow waterways and dock in the heart of cities like Seville, Bordeaux, and Venice, where larger ships are relegated to industrial ports miles away.

Engineering Profile
The R-Class Platform
Azamara's entire fleet is built on the storied R-Class platform. These ships are widely considered some of the most successful boutique designs in maritime history. Their engineering is optimized for port accessibility; they are small enough to utilize city-center docks while large enough to maintain stability in open-ocean crossings.
Shallow Draft Accessibility
With a draft of only 5.95 meters (19.5 feet), Azamara vessels can navigate waterways that are off-limits to 90% of the modern cruise fleet. This shallow draft is the technical prerequisite for their "River-to-Sea" itineraries, allowing them to sail up the Guadalquivir River to the heart of Seville, Spain.
2024 Technical Modernization
The fleet recently underwent a 2024 technical refresh to upgrade propulsion efficiency and environmental compliance. This included the installation of advanced wastewater treatment systems and hull coatings designed to reduce drag, ensuring these classic vessels meet the stringent Tier III emission standards required for modern European deployment.
